Understanding the Risks of Solar Street Light Battery Theft

The rise of renewable energy has led to increased installations of solar street lights. However, these systems are vulnerable to battery theft. Understanding the risks associated with solar street light battery theft is crucial for municipalities and property owners. Batteries are often the most valuable component, making them a target for thieves. A simple removal can provide quick cash for perpetrators.

Areas with inadequate lighting or high foot traffic can be hotspots for these crimes. Those responsible for installation must assess risks before placing solar street lights. Anonymity often emboldens thieves, who can act quickly without detection. Lack of surveillance and alarms makes removal easier. This reality should encourage proactive measures.

It's important to consider the weaknesses in current installations. Are you using secure fittings for batteries? What about alarms or cameras? These questions must be examined. Regular inspections can also help identify vulnerabilities. While solutions exist, they require commitment. Innovative Strategies for Securing Solar Street Light Batteries

In recent years, theft of solar street light batteries has become a pressing concern. Innovative strategies are essential for securing these vital components. A 2023 report by the Solar Industry Association revealed that battery theft can increase project costs by up to 20%. This economic impact signals the need for actionable solutions.

One effective method involves using tamper-proof battery enclosures. These enclosures are designed with reinforced materials that resist break-ins. Additionally, integrating GPS tracking systems into battery units can provide real-time location data. Such measures can deter thieves and enable timely recovery of stolen items.

Community engagement plays a key role as well. Creating neighborhood watch programs can foster local vigilance. Studies show that areas with active community involvement report 35% fewer thefts. Encouraging citizens to report suspicious activities can help protect solar infrastructure. However, trust and cooperation between residents and local authorities are crucial for this approach to succeed.

Effective Alarm and Surveillance Systems for Battery Protection

In recent years, theft of solar street light batteries has risen sharply. An alarming report from the National Renewable Energy Laboratory states that battery thefts can cost municipalities over $1 million annually. To combat this, effective alarm and surveillance systems are essential. Implementing a multi-faceted approach can greatly enhance battery protection.

Integrating motion sensors with high-decibel alarms deters potential thieves. These systems can send real-time alerts to local authorities. Surveillance cameras equipped with night vision can monitor installations, providing clear evidence if theft occurs. According to a study by the Solar Energy Industries Association, locations with surveillance are 30% less likely to experience theft.

However, not all communities can afford high-end systems. Some may rely on basic solutions. Analyzing their local environment and customizing surveillance plans is crucial. Even simple deterrents, like signage, can make a difference. It’s important to assess the effectiveness of various strategies continuously. Regular Maintenance and Monitoring of Solar Street Light Installations

Regular maintenance and monitoring of solar street lights play a crucial role in preventing theft of batteries. Regular checks on installations help identify signs of tampering. A simple visual inspection can reveal loose connections or damaged components. If you see anything unusual, it’s time to act. Regular maintenance schedules should involve checking the battery housing and securing bolts.

A monitoring system can enhance security as well. Cameras installed near solar street lights can deter potential thieves. They serve as both a means of evidence and a protective measure. Additionally, gather reports on the overall performance of the lights. Unexpected dimming may indicate theft. Keep records of maintenance and inspections to track trends and areas that need improvement.

Even with the best systems, vulnerabilities exist. Frequent checks are necessary, but they require commitment. Engage local community members in monitoring efforts. Their presence can help reduce theft opportunities. Involve them in discussions about the lighting's importance in public safety. Monitoring Aspect Method Frequency Responsibility Comments
Visual Inspection Check for physical tampering Weekly Field Technician Immediate reporting of issues
Battery Voltage Check Measure voltage levels Monthly Maintenance Team Replace batteries below threshold
Component Security Inspect locks and enclosures Biweekly Security Officer Upgrade locks as necessary
Surveillance Footage Review Analyze camera recordings Monthly Security Team Look for suspicious activity
Community Awareness Engage local residents Quarterly Outreach Coordinator Encourage reporting of theft
